4 - CONTROLS AND COMPONENTS

4.1 - BRAKE PEDAL

This pedal allows the operator to hold the wheel when fitting the counterweights. It must not be actuated

during the measuring cycle.

4.2 - AUTOMATIC DISTANCE AND DIAMETER GAUGE

This gauge allows measurement of the distance of the wheel from the machine and the wheel diameter at

the point of application of the counterweight.

It also allows correct positioning of the counterweights on the inside by using the specific function (see

INDICATION OF EXACT CORRECTION WEIGHT POSITION

) which allows reading, on the monitor, the position used

for the measurement within the rim (For calibration, see

GAUGE CALIBRATION

).

The gauge can only be used with the counterweight pincers mounted.

4.3 - AUTOMATIC WIDTH GAUGE (OPTIONAL)

Width gauging is through a SONAR device which measures the distance of the wheel without mechanical

contact, merely by closing the guard and each time a valid measurement has been made with gauge

DISTANCE AND DIAMETER GAUGE

.

4.4 - AUTOMATIC WHEEL POSITIONING

At the end of the spin, the wheel is positioned according to the unbalance on the outside or else

according to the static unbalance (when selected).

Accuracy is +/-20 degrees.
